一、關於定位
1.相對定位下,不需要設定塊級元素的寬度,只需要設定高度,即可以使該塊級元素自適應,如果內有固定高度子元素,可以不設高度。而且可以進行top left定位。
2.相對定位下,如果兩個兄弟塊級元素,其中一者設定了left,而另乙個只要設定的left數值和兄弟不同,left小的那個就不會佔滿整個橫向螢幕,但是二者的自適應寬度一樣。
3.絕對定位下,必須要為該元素定義寬高,除非內部包含設定寬高子元素,否則不可見。
4.浮動情況下,該元素的margin會失效,同時需要為該元素設定寬高,除非內部有設定寬高的子元素。
二、文字控制
1.li、p面對沒有空格的 數字、字母串是不會換行的,因為它認為你這乙個單詞沒有完,所以需要在樣式中加入 : word-wrap : break-word; 就ok了。
2.在支援html5的前提下,一般opacity 或filter的透明度會將元素內的文字也置為透明,所以需要引入rgba 或hsla,這樣透明度就僅侷限在該元素上了。
三、塊級元素
1.img標籤雖然是塊級元素,但不會存在margin塌陷問題。
四、行級元素
1.行級元素包含塊級元素後,ifc就將不復存在。換句話說:兩個行級元素無法同行。
2.塊級元素和行級元素不會併排,但是當父容器的高度和子塊級元素相同時,如果寬度足夠容納下子行級元素的面積時,塊級元素會和行級元素併排,否則還是不併排。
css知識積累
html文字溢位出現.效果 test 兩行文字後溢位出現.效果 test label的作用 通過for將label區域和input產生關聯,點選label即選中input label for test1 選項一 label input type radio name memory id test1 ...
css基礎積累
1 以統一的方式實現樣式的定義 2 提高頁面樣式的可重用性和可維護性 3 實現了內容 html 和表 css 的分離 html和css之間有什麼關係 html 構建網頁的結構 css 構建html元素的樣式 1.內聯樣式 將樣式宣告在元素的style屬性中 1 color 樣式宣告 表示乙個具體的顯...
知識的積累
最初認識darwin 的時候,我還是個沒畢業的新手。那時,我在公司做畢業設計,題目就是用c 對部門內已有的一套c的庫進行封裝。那套庫就是darwin開發的,這次封裝工作也是在他的領導之下進行的。當時,我對c 有著說不清的好感,心裡認定那是成為高手的必經之路,因此很樂於參加到這個工作之中。darwin...